Painting Description
"Ramsgate Harbour; Landing Fish, Etables" is a notable painting by the British artist Thomas Bush Hardy, who is renowned for his maritime scenes and coastal landscapes. Hardy, born in 1842, developed a keen interest in the sea, which is vividly reflected in his extensive body of work. His paintings often capture the dynamic interplay between human activity and the natural environment, particularly focusing on the bustling life of harbors and the serene beauty of coastal vistas.
This particular painting, "Ramsgate Harbour; Landing Fish, Etables," exemplifies Hardy's meticulous attention to detail and his ability to convey the atmosphere of a working harbor. Ramsgate Harbour, located in Kent, England, has historically been a significant site for maritime trade and fishing, and Hardy's depiction brings to life the daily activities that characterized this vibrant locale. The painting likely dates back to the late 19th or early 20th century, a period when Hardy was at the height of his artistic career.
In "Ramsgate Harbour; Landing Fish, Etables," Hardy employs a realistic style, capturing the textures and colors of the sea, sky, and vessels with remarkable precision. The composition typically features fishermen unloading their catch, boats moored at the docks, and the architectural elements of the harbor, all rendered with a keen eye for detail and a deep appreciation for the maritime culture. The artist's use of light and shadow enhances the sense of realism and brings a dynamic quality to the scene, making the viewer feel almost present in the moment.
Hardy's works, including this painting, are celebrated for their historical and cultural significance, providing a window into the maritime heritage of England. "Ramsgate Harbour; Landing Fish, Etables" not only showcases Hardy's technical skill but also serves as a valuable document of the everyday life and industry of coastal communities during his time.
